P0751 on 2015-2019 GMC Savana: Shift Solenoid 'A' Causes and Fixes
On a 2015-2019 GMC Savana with a 6L80 or 6L90 transmission, code P0751 is most often caused by a sticking Clutch Select Solenoid Valve 2 (also known as Shift Solenoid 'A'), a well-documented issue in GM Technical Service Bulletins. The fix involves replacing the solenoid inside the transmission oil pan, which is a moderately difficult job that requires dropping the pan and valve body.
- P0751 on a 2015-2019 Savana points directly to a problem with Shift Solenoid 'A' (Clutch Select Solenoid Valve 2).
- The most likely cause is the solenoid itself sticking, a known issue confirmed by GM.
- The fix requires dropping the transmission pan to replace the solenoid.
- While you're performing the repair, it's wise to also replace the transmission filter, pan gasket, and potentially the other main shift solenoid ('B').
- Always use the correct DEXRON VI transmission fluid when refilling.
What's Unique About the 2015-2019 Gmc SAVANA
General Motors has specifically identified a problem on this platform (and many others using the 6L-series transmissions) where the Clutch Select Solenoid Valve 2 can stick internally. This known issue, documented in Technical Service Bulletins (TSBs), makes the solenoid itself the primary suspect, more so than on other vehicles where wiring or fluid issues might be equally likely. The problem leads directly to the symptoms described by owners, such as slipping from a stop, poor acceleration, and feeling like the van is starting in a high gear.

Symptoms You May Notice
- Reduced acceleration at low speed.
- Transmission slipping when accelerating from a stop.
- Vehicle feels like it is starting in a higher gear (e.g., 4th gear).
- Harsh or delayed gear shifts.
- Transmission gets stuck in one gear (limp mode).
- Check Engine Light is on.
- Reduced fuel economy.
- Transmission may overheat.

Most Likely Causes
- Sticking Clutch Select Solenoid Valve 2 (Shift Solenoid 'A') 🔴 High Probability This is a known issue documented by GM in TSBs #PI1344B and #PI1344C 🎬 Watch: Expert breakdown of the P0751 code and GM TSBs., which state this specific solenoid is prone to sticking in its bore within the lower valve body of 6L80/6L90 transmissions.
How to confirm: A technician can command the solenoid on and off with a bi-directional scan tool to check its response. TSB PI1344C also details a solenoid performance test using compressed air. Visual inspection after removal may show scratches on the valve, which confirms the issue.
Typical fix: Replace the faulty shift solenoid. Per TSB PI1344C, if the valve is stuck or shows any scratches, the entire lower valve body should be replaced. Many technicians recommend replacing the full solenoid pack/assembly while the pan is off.
Est. part cost: $40-$80 for a single aftermarket solenoid, though OEM replacement may require a full solenoid pack or valve body assembly costing several hundred dollars. - Low or Dirty Transmission Fluid 🟡 Medium Probability
How to confirm: Check the transmission fluid level and condition. On these transmissions, this is done via a fill plug on the pan as there is no dipstick. The fluid should be at the correct level, red in color, and not smell burnt. Dark, dirty, or fluid containing debris indicates a problem.
Typical fix: Perform a transmission fluid and filter change using DEXRON VI fluid. If the fluid is heavily contaminated with metal shavings, a transmission flush or further diagnosis is needed as this may indicate a more severe internal failure.
Est. part cost: $60-$150 for fluid and a new filter. - Faulty Wiring or Connector ⚪ Low Probability
How to confirm: Visually inspect the main wiring harness connector at the transmission case for any signs of damage, corrosion, or loose pins. The internal harness leading to the solenoid can also be a failure point, which requires removing the pan to inspect.
Typical fix: Repair the damaged section of wiring or replace the corroded connector. In some cases, the internal transmission wiring harness may need replacement.
Est. part cost: $20-$200 depending on the extent of the damage.
Rare But Worth Checking
- Faulty Transmission Control Module (TCM): This is rare and should only be considered after all other possibilities have been ruled out. On 6L80/6L90 transmissions, the TCM (sometimes called TEHCM) is located inside the transmission, mounted to the valve body. Failure often presents with other communication codes (U-codes) in addition to P0751.
- Clogged Valve Body Passages: Debris from normal wear can clog the small passages in the valve body that the solenoid controls. This requires removing and cleaning or replacing the entire valve body, a complex job. 🎬 Watch: Detailed tear down of the 6L80 valve body assembly. The TSB for P0751 specifically points to the solenoid valve itself sticking in its bore as the primary cause.
Diagnosis Steps
- Check the transmission fluid level and condition. This requires raising the vehicle and removing a fill plug, as there is no dipstick. Top off or change if necessary, using only DEXRON VI fluid.
- Use an OBD-II scanner to check for other transmission-related codes, especially P0700.
- Connect a bi-directional scan tool to command the Shift Solenoid 'A' (PC Solenoid 2) on and off to test its mechanical function.
- If the solenoid doesn't respond or tests fail, drain the transmission fluid and remove the transmission pan to access the valve body and solenoids.
- Visually inspect the wiring and connectors inside the pan for any obvious damage.
- Follow TSB PI1344C procedure: remove the lower valve body and inspect the Clutch Select Solenoid Valve 2. Check for scratches on the valve or if it is stuck in the bore.
- If the valve is scratched or damaged, replace the lower valve body as recommended by GM. If it appears okay, test the solenoid's resistance with a multimeter. An open or shorted reading confirms a bad solenoid.
- If wiring and the solenoid are confirmed good, the issue may be a blockage in another part of the valve body or a faulty TCM.

Related Codes That Often Appear With This One
- P0756 — This code is for Shift Solenoid 'B' Performance. It's common to see codes for other solenoids if the root cause is dirty fluid, a failing internal harness, or a failing TCM affecting multiple components.
- P0700 — This is a generic transmission fault code that simply indicates the TCM has stored a specific fault code (like P0751). It's an informational code that points the technician to the transmission system.

Platform-Specific Known Issues
- A known condition exists where the Clutch Select Solenoid Valve 2 may stick in its bore, causing reduced acceleration and/or transmission slipping from a launch, which sets DTC P0751.
- This condition can be very intermittent and result in the transmission starting in 4th gear from a stop.
- GM's official recommendation per TSB PI1344C is to inspect the valve for scratches; if any are found, the entire lower valve body must be replaced, not just the solenoid.
Mechanic-Grade Diagnostic Values
- Shift Solenoid (On/Off type) resistance — expected: 20 - 40 Ohms. Failure: A reading of infinite (open circuit) or near zero (short circuit) Ohms indicates a failed solenoid.
- Pressure Control Solenoid (PWM type) resistance — expected: 3 - 8 Ohms. Failure: A reading outside this range indicates a failed solenoid.
- Shift Solenoid (On/Off type) current draw — expected: 0.3 - 0.7 Amps at 12V. Failure: Incorrect amperage reading indicates a failed solenoid.
- Solenoid power supply voltage — expected: ~12.6V (Battery Voltage). Failure: A voltage drop greater than 0.5V suggests a wiring or ground issue.
Scan Tool Commands That Help
- GM GDS2 / MDI2 or equivalent J2534 device: Service Fast Learn Adapts — This procedure is mandatory after replacing the TEHCM, valve body, or entire transmission. It resets and relearns clutch fill volumes and shift timing. Failure to perform this can result in harsh shifts, slipping, and premature wear.
- GM GDS2 / MDI2 or equivalent J2534 device: Solenoid Activation / Output Control — Used to command a specific solenoid on and off while the engine is running to verify mechanical response. When used with a test plate on the bench, a technician can check for correct air pressure release, confirming the solenoid is not stuck.
- GM GDS2 / MDI2 or equivalent J2534 device: TCM Programming — When installing a new or remanufactured TEHCM, it must be flashed with the vehicle's specific VIN and the correct calibration file from GM's service site. The vehicle will not start or shift correctly until this is done.
Wiring & Ground Locations
- External Transmission Connector — On the passenger side of the transmission case, where the main vehicle harness connects to the transmission's internal harness.. This 16-pin connector is a critical point for all communication between the vehicle and the TEHCM. Corrosion or damage from heat can cause intermittent connection loss, triggering various transmission codes, including P0751. A common repair involves replacing the pigtail (p/n 350-0168 is a known repair kit).
- Chassis and Engine Block Grounds — Multiple points connecting the negative battery cable to the vehicle frame/chassis and the engine block.. The TEHCM relies on a solid ground connection through the engine and chassis. A corroded or loose ground can cause erratic behavior, voltage drops, and communication errors that may be misdiagnosed as an internal TEHCM or solenoid failure.

OEM Part Supersession History
Various, e.g., 24256939, 24259835→Various, e.g., 24275873, GM6L-TEHCM-C6 (Sonnax Reman)— GM has revised the TEHCM (the assembly containing the TCM and solenoids) multiple times to address component failures and update software logic.
Heads up: TEHCMs are NOT interchangeable between years or models without correct programming. They are identified by a 'Tag ID' and must be programmed with the specific vehicle's VIN and calibration file. Installing the wrong TEHCM can result in a no-start condition, immediate limp mode, or other faults.
Model Year Variations Within This Range
- 2015-2019: While the core issue with the P0751 solenoid remains consistent, the specific TEHCM hardware and software ('Tag ID') can vary by model year and vehicle application (6L80 vs 6L90). When replacing the TEHCM, it is critical to source the correct part for the vehicle's VIN and ensure it is programmed with the latest calibration, as an incorrect module will not function properly.
